My understanding is the pkg autoremove command removes all unused packages, and I have used the command to successfully clean up my system. However, when I ran it this morning, the system told me I could recover 2gigs by removing 333 unused packages. Of course, let's remove them! But that action rendered my system unusable, turned it into a brick. Had to restore a backup.
What am I missing about this once useful command to removed unused packages and restore some disk space?
Thanks in advance. Running FreeBSD 14.2 p2 in a Virtual Machine using VMware 17.6.2.
